How do I update a Finale 2005 score to the current version of Finale?

Windows Finale or Mac Finale?

 

Anyway, try changing the file name extension to .musx - and now it should be possible to open the v2005 document in v27.

Then, v27 will convert the v2005 file format to the v27 file format.

Then, save the v27 format document, and you are done.

(in Windows) you don't need to change the file extension. Just open it like any file, it opens as "Untitled"

Then give it a name and it'll be saved in the new .musx format (without changing anything in the original file)
